Seattle, Washington vs. Staten Island, New York

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Staten Island, New York is 7.7% cheaper than Seattle, Washington.

You would need a salary of $46,126 in Staten Island, New York to maintain the standard of living you have in Seattle, Washington.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Staten Island, New York is cheaper than Seattle, Washington
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
